Best Sherman Village Public Middle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 387 students in the neighborhood of Sherman Village, Madison, WI.
The top-ranked public middle school in Sherman Village is Black Hawk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Sherman Village, Madison, WI public middle school have an average math proficiency score of 12% (versus the Wisconsin public middle school average of 36%), and reading proficiency score of 22% (versus the 36%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 72%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Wisconsin public middle school average of 40% (majority Hispanic and Black).
